Show simple item record

dc.rights.licenseCC-BY-NC-ND
dc.contributor.advisorDalipaz, F.
dc.contributor.authorElbakush, A.S.H.
dc.date.accessioned2019-01-28T18:00:27Z
dc.date.available2019-01-28T18:00:27Z
dc.date.issued2018
dc.identifier.urihttps://studenttheses.uu.nl/handle/20.500.12932/31756
dc.description.abstractWe are living in a world that is rapidly growing digitally, and businesses are becoming increasingly dependent on information. In order to adapt to this growth, and gain competitive advantage, businesses seek new innovative approaches and communication channels to extract new software requirements from online user data. Previous and current research mainly focus their efforts on exploring social media and mobile application platforms for requirements discovery and extraction. In this research, we focus on exploring requirement extraction for desktop applications from technical user forums. We build a prototype tool for scraping a user forum, processing the textual data with NLP tools, and visualizing the resulting data using a visual analytics tool. The classification accuracy on the data set is between 60-90% while the recall between 80-90%. The Naïve Bayes Classifier outperformed other binary classifiers for the data of this research domain. We conducted experiments and interviewed experts to evaluate the perceived usefulness of our prototype. Results show positive feedback on our prototype as effective and efficient tool to support product managers discovering requirements and new markets.
dc.description.sponsorshipUtrecht University
dc.format.extent2265382
dc.format.mimetypeapplication/pdf
dc.language.isoen
dc.titleRequirements Engineering in the World of Apps
dc.type.contentMaster Thesis
dc.rights.accessrightsOpen Access
dc.subject.keywordsUser feedback, Autodesk forum, requirement discovery, NLP, data mining, perceived usefulness
dc.subject.courseuuBusiness Informatics


Files in this item

Thumbnail

This item appears in the following Collection(s)

Show simple item record